Dallas city officials gathered on June 3, 2025, to address critical issues surrounding workforce education and equity, emphasizing their commitment to enhancing community services. The meeting opened with a strong call to action from council members, highlighting the need for dedicated efforts to meet the needs of Dallas residents.
Assistant City Manager Lycidio Pereira expressed gratitude for the collaborative spirit among committee members, setting a positive tone for the discussions ahead. The focus of the meeting was to explore strategies that would improve access to educational resources and job training programs, particularly for underserved communities in Dallas.
